// Client setup for the Pixelthresh batch resize CLI.
// Talks to the internal Grindery asset service over mTLS.
// Rate limits: 200 req/min, enforced server-side.
// Scope is read-resize only; no delete permissions granted.
// Key rotates quarterly via the Ops vault job.
// The current service key follows on the next line.

gateway credential: kto3_qfe

## Further Reading

Zero-downtime schema migrations in Cratewell follow the expand-migrate-contract pattern. Never drop or rename columns in one release. Backfills run through the Sandglass job runner with rate limits; dual writes stay enabled until verification passes. Rollbacks must be forward-compatible. Before writing any migration, read the full playbook, including lock-avoidance rules and the verification checklist, maintained on the internal page below.

operations page: https://confluence.qorvellabs.internal/pages/projects/projects/projects

Vaultwren, our internal secrets-rotation utility, tracks rotation history in a dedicated ledger database so it can detect stale credentials and schedule re-rotation. During this migration the ledger moves off the shared Pellbrook cluster onto its own instance, which means the old config entry will silently fail after cutover. Update the ledger setting in vaultwren.conf before restarting the daemon, then verify with a dry-run rotation. Set the ledger database using the connection string below.

primary connection of tawif-yajeg = postgresql://rusiel_svc:G879q9cx6GsSvj@db-dd9f.norvagrid.internal:5432/casath

Subject: Kiosk watchdog cut-over complete

Team,

The cut-over of the OrchardPoint kiosk watchdog finished Saturday night. All 46 kiosks now run the new supervisor, which restarts the shell app on freeze and reports heartbeat gaps to the Brightlea monitor. Old cron-based restarts are disabled; if you see one still firing, flag it rather than re-enabling it. New joiners: the watchdog reads a single config file at boot, and nothing else overrides it. For reference, the settings now deployed to every kiosk are as follows.

service settings:
PRAIX_LOG_LEVEL=error
PRAIX_METRICS_HOST=metrics.praix.qorvelcorp.corp
PRAIX_POOL_SIZE=16